Output bf85e067831ec9c5f25befd13194b979b46539b64bd6c41ac5a22f0894194ba4:4

value
516366340
script pubkey
OP_0 OP_PUSHBYTES_20 124595e42ddc31cc698c201bc761147d2fb99538
address
ltc1qzfzetepdmscuc6vvyqduwcg505hmn9fcysn6qj
transaction
bf85e067831ec9c5f25befd13194b979b46539b64bd6c41ac5a22f0894194ba4
spent
true